Transaction 58123f71444437dd80391505410b87fd1488ba50ad8d9fe8292932d49cfd9b03

1 Input
2 Outputs
  • 58123f71444437dd80391505410b87fd1488ba50ad8d9fe8292932d49cfd9b03:0
  • value  7565358
    address  3HHCd8ZDZKfzsKVr7NqGihwiFe6AMDxdVW
  • 58123f71444437dd80391505410b87fd1488ba50ad8d9fe8292932d49cfd9b03:1
  • value  15320238
    address  bc1q6wqyv7ftxs0dpaf65u0tmnt487v6swztykqmwj